  • Item Number: 90000021382
  • Tire Size: LT265/70R17
  • Load Range: E
  • Service Description: 121/118S
  • Speed Rating: S
  • Load Index: 121/118
  • Sidewall Style: BK
  • UTQG Treadwear: 560
  • UTQG Temperature: B
  • Tread Depth: 17/32"

I'm running these on my 3500 cumins dually's , I town very heavy loads . I'm rated for over 30000 and these tires make that hauling go smoothly. The only complaint I would say I have is the mileage could be better , but you have to remember I do a lot of hauling and they are on dually's ! Besides that I use these on 3 different trucks and have never had a issue . I'll keep using the cooper star fires .

car went through all the snow we had... the noise level was much higher than summer tires. but car drives in snow like it was summer , it was great. ...and unlike buying soft winter tires and having to switch to summer tires..
